Did you need to put anything on the seams ? Also did you use nails or screws ?
Nope, nothing on the seems and just used brad nails. I would recommend using glue as well if you already have some sort of wall to glue it to. Will help it to keep from stretching/shrinking with humidity

Have you had any warping on the paneling from humidity?
Yes unfortunately. If I had glued it to a backer board it would have been OK but on real humid days it does warp quite a bit. The good news is once the humidity comes down they return to normal but it's something to consider for sure.
